Add an 'Email' action to Cases in Salesforce for Android and iOS

The process for setting up an 'Email' action on a Case varies, depending on when your organization was created, and whether Email-to-Case feature is enabled.

Organizations that were created after Summer 14', or Email-to-Case was enabled after Summer '14:

  • Once Email-to-Case is enabled, an 'Email' action (API name 'Case.SendEmail') is automatically created and added to the list of available actions in the page layout editor.

Add the action to the 'Mobile & Lightning Actions' on the Case page layout:

IMPORTANT : The Email action on Cases is not currently supported if you have enabled the Dynamic Actions for Mobile setting under Setup : Salesforce Mobile App , Enable Dynamic Actions on Mobile. If you have this setting enabled, disabling it will allow you to use the Email action from Cases.  

Note: If you are still using the Classic UI and Enable Case Feed Actions and Feed Items , then add the Email action only to the 'Mobile & Lightning Actions' of the Case page layout, it will not appear in Salesforce Classic full site. To ensure it also shows in Classic, also add to the 'Quick Actions' of the Case page layout.
